After flying high against Anna last Tuesday, Walnut Grove came back down to earth. The Walnut Grove Wildcats took a 3-1 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Melissa Cardinals on Friday. While the Wildcats didn't get the win, they did start the game off strong, beating the Cardinals 25-21 in the first set.
Walnut Grove started the match hot and won the first set, but they struggled down the stretch and lost the last three. The match finished with set scores of 21-25, 25-20, 25-23, 25-22.
Walnut Grove's defeat dropped their record down to 22-14. As for Melissa, their victory was their 11th straight on the road dating back to last season, which pushed their record up to 29-6.
Walnut Grove has already played their next match, a 3-0 win against Denison on the 8th. As for Melissa, they also did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next contest, a 3-0 victory against Greenville on the 8th.
